The string "Intel64 Family 6 Model 140 Stepping 1 GenuineIntel 2803 MHz" is a technical identifier for the Intel Core i7-1165G7, an 11th Generation "Tiger Lake" processor. This specific model was a cornerstone of high-end ultrabooks and compact industrial PCs upon its release in late 2020. Decoding the Technical Identifier
System information tools like msinfo32 or Linux cpuinfo display this string to define the processor's architecture and revision:
Intel64 Family 6: Indicates the x86-64 instruction set and the long-standing Intel "Family 6" microarchitecture lineage.
Model 140: The specific internal model number for the Tiger Lake-U series.
Stepping 1: Refers to the physical revision of the silicon. Early revisions like "Stepping 1" are standard for the first commercial waves of a chip.
2803 MHz (2.8 GHz): This is the Configurable TDP-up base frequency. While the standard base clock is lower (often 1.2 GHz at 12W), this 2.8 GHz figure indicates the chip is operating in its high-performance 28W mode. Core Specifications and Performance

Part 1: The "Family 6" Legacy
First, forget everything you think you know about Core i3/i5/i7. Intel’s internal numbering is far more logical (and ancient).
- Family 6 means this is a 64-bit x86 processor belonging to Intel’s most successful architectural lineage. Almost every modern Intel CPU since the Pentium Pro (1995) is Family 6. Yes, your 1998 Pentium II, your 2010 Core i7, and your 2024 Raptor Lake chip? All Family 6.
- Intel reserved Family 5 for Pentium and Family 15 for NetBurst (the infamous Pentium 4). Family 6 outlived them all.
